While most NES games were side scrollers, players remembered Zelda as revolutionary in terms of game play. Instead of always moving forward or backward, the user could truly explore the world, moving in all directions. In fact, exploration was one of the most integral formal materialities of the game. The user is required to explore, going back and forth through towns, castles, and forests in search of what was next, unlike even Castlevania which required the user to explore, but only in terms of going back and forth.
